Shopify Alternative in Egypt
An honest comparison: Shopify is the stronger storefront, Pashkateb brings the store and the books together in EGP.
Shopify is an excellent store platform, but it leaves accounting and inventory to other software and bills in dollars. Pashkateb is an Egyptian alternative at 300 EGP a month that includes the storefront, inventory, invoicing, and accounting, with cash on delivery as a first-class payment method. If you are staying on Shopify, there is a ready integration between the two.

Where Shopify is stronger
- A very large app marketplace with a ready solution for almost anything
- Far more themes and design options
- Global payment and shipping options if you sell outside Egypt
- A mature ecosystem and a large developer community
Where Pashkateb is stronger for an Egyptian merchant
- Priced in EGP, with no exchange-rate exposure
- Accounting and inventory inside the subscription, not a second bill beside it
- Cash on delivery as a core payment method rather than an add-on
- Arabic RTL throughout the storefront and the dashboard
- Every order posts to invoices and customer balances by itself
You do not have to choose
If your Shopify store is running well, you do not need to move it. Pashkateb integrates with Shopify to pull orders, stock, and customer data into the accounting system, so you can keep selling on Shopify and close your books here.
When moving is worth it
- When Shopify plus accounting software together become a real monthly burden
- When you spend every month moving numbers between the store and the books
- When most of your customers pay cash on delivery
- When you sell only in Egypt and do not need a global ecosystem
